WebDec 1, 2001 · EphA4 is predominantly localized to delaminating and migrating Pax-7-positive muscle precursors whereas ephrin-A5 is primarily distributed in the forelimb mesoderm. The expression patterns of these factors suggests that they could play multiple roles in early muscle development. WebEphrin-A4 is a 201 aa polypeptide with a 22 aa signal sequence and a 179 aa mature segment. 18 The mature protein has one potential N-linked glycosylation site and seven cysteines. Ephrin-A4 binds to EphA4 with a Kd = 5 nM and to EphB1 with a Kd = 20 nM. 18 Mouse and human ephrin-A4 show 86% aa identity in the mature segment. 12

WebEphA4 is enriched on dendritic spines of pyramidal neurons in the adult mouse hippocampus, and ephrin-A3 is localized on astrocytic processes that envelop spines. Activation of EphA4 by ephrin-A3 was found to induce spine retraction, whereas inhibiting ephrin/EphA4 interactions distorted spine shape and organization in hippocampal slices.
